I wouldn't go bigger than .82 in single scroll - just to be clear, Garrett do different numbers for their single scroll and twin scroll T3 sizes. The single are .63, .82 and 1.06 and the twin are .61, .83 and 1.01. The .82 would be the go with single, just NORMALLY it seems that to get equivalent performance from a twin scroll housing you go up a size - but that's a sweeping assumption and will really depend on the design as well

AFAIK if you can fit a GT3582R on the standard manifold you can fit a GT3076 HTA because dimensionally they are the same .

FP have an alternative compressor housing which you can see if you go to their site . I think its based on a TC06 housing and is port shrouded . If serious email them and ask if it makes any notable difference with this housing .

Go back to the site and look in the Lancer Evolution/Diamond star or Subaru sections and open the FP Turbos section in any of these .

You'll see pics of these turbos with FPs "84mm FAP" or flow advancement port covers - comp housings on them .

They still claim 59 pounds a minute air flow but I'd say they fit more easily in the engine bays of Evos Rexs Diamond stars and DSMs .

If it works for them I can't see any reason why it wouldn't on a Nissan RB engine . I can't see why you can't order these turbos with any GT30 turbine housing you like or without if you have your own already .
